The baby name Keyon is a unisex name, 2 syllables long and is pronounced "kee-yawn".
Keyon is a name of American origin, which means "God is gracious". It is a modern name that has gained popularity in recent years. The name Keyon is often given to boys, but it can also be used for girls. The name has a positive connotation and is associated with kindness, generosity, and compassion.
The name Keyon is derived from the Hebrew name John, which means "God is gracious". The name John has been popular for centuries and has been used by many famous people throughout history. The name Keyon is a modern variation of John and has become popular in the United States in recent years. The name is often used by African American parents, but it is also used by parents of other ethnicities.
The pronunciation of Keyon is kee-yawn. The name is composed of two syllables, with the stress on the first syllable. The name is easy to pronounce and has a pleasant sound.
